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Community Strategies Inc show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:
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Community Strategies Inc's revenue has grown by 5623.3%, moving from $4.2M to $240.2M. Total assets increased by 19098.2% over the same period, from $418K to $80.2M. Total functional expenses rose by 5487.9%, from $4.0M to $221.2M. In its most recent filing year (2023), Community Strategies Inc reported a surplus of $19.0M,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$4.6M in liabilities against $80.2M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 5.7%), resulting in net assets of $75.6M.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
